What is an analogue drug?
Analogs or generics are drugs that do not have a patent, do not differ in composition from the patented development. However, all these drugs are different from the original drugs in the qualitative and quantitative composition of additional substances.
An analogue is a kind of copy, but not a fake! After the expiration of the license for original medicines, manufacturers quickly copy the composition of the drug, replacing some of the ingredients with cheaper ones. As a result, pharmacies abound in offering their customers cheaper drugs. And the companies that developed the original, did a lot of work on testing and research, eventually lose sales markets. Copies and fakes
In addition to analogues, there are still copies of drugs that are truly counterfeit products. So, in Belarus they tried to launch an analogue of the anti-influenza drug “Tamiflu” in production, while raw materials of dubious quality were purchased in China. The result was that the drug produced does not have any therapeutic effect.

Black list of Roszdravnadzor
Roszdravnadzor has identified a blacklist of pharmaceutical companies. That is, their interchangeable drugs (table), which are analogues of world famous brands, are best not used in treatment. It was established by the test method that the medicines produced at these plants are of dubious quality. Among them: "Belmedpreparaty", "Tatpharmkhimpreparaty", "Biochemist", "Herbion Pakistan", "Farmak", "Sagmel Inc", "Dalhimpharm", "Biosynthesis" and others.
